Description

Glass from floor-to-ceiling and from wall-to-wall, fixed or sliding windows – Sky-Frame, the high-tech frameless window makes it possible, opens areas up to 4 m high, and fulfills the highest standards and all current building regulations. 


Sky-Frame 2: Thanks to its excellent sound insulation and thermal insulation values, due to the 30 mm slim double glazing units (2-IGU), Sky-Frame 2 performs very well in many different climate zones.

Sky-Frame 3: The Sky-Frame 3 technology meets the highest of standards with its 54-mm thick triple insulated glass units (3-IGU). 

Sky-Frame 3 sliding windows can also be used in the passive house area and have been certified as MINERGIE® and MINERGIE-P® module windows.


Sky-Frame 2 doors:

  • Virtually frameless: A 20 mm sightline means the visuals of these sliding glass doors are discrete and unobtrusive.
  • Fully thermally broken technology provides exceptional insulation.
  • Sleek design: Minimal handles and locks galvanize the stylish design.
  • Available in both fixed and sliding panels.
  • Secure and robust, with full security options including alarm system integration.
  • All the technical features of a Sky-Frame solution, with double-glazing for excellent sound and thermal control.
  • Wide variety of options and features, including connections to alarm systems, remotely controlled, motorized opening and integrated insect screens.


Sky-Frame 3 doors:

  • 54 mm triple-glazed units mean Sky-Frame 3 offers the very highest insulation standards.
  • Despite thicker unit depth, Sky-Frame 3 is still virtually frameless, with a mere 20 mm sightline.
  • Top quality insulation: can achieve ultra-low U-values under 1.0 W/m²K.
  • Outstanding sound insulation of up to 44 decibels.
  • Strong wind-resistance, tested up to 2 kN/m².


Sky-Frame Arc:

  • Available with either double-glazed or triple-glazed units to accommodate any insulation requirements.
  • Create a completely bespoke feature as Sky-Frame’s world renowned R&D department will accommodate any radius.
  • Thermal insulation and sun-protection coating.
  • Combines seamlessly with rectilinear Sky-Frame options, and can complement other Cantifix installations such as glass roofs and curved glass balustrades.
  • Retains frameless effect of all Sky-Frame products.

Additional properties

Glass type
Standard., Hurricane glass.
-
-
Thermal transmittance (U-Value)
To SIA 311, 1.25 W/m²K; to EN 10077, 1.36 W/m²K (glass Ug = 1.1).
To SIA 311, 1.15 W/m²K; to EN 10077, 1.27 W/m²K (glass Ug = 1.0).
-
-
Watertightness
To EN 12208/ EN 1027, 6A (up to 9A).
-
-
Air permeability
To EN 12207/ EN 1026, 3 (up to 4).
-
-
Wind load resistance
To EN 12210/ EN 12211, C5.
-
-
Sound insulation
To EN ISO 717-1/ EN ISO 10140, 39 dB (Rw,P,Glas)/ 37 dB (Rw,P).
-
-
Security
To EN 1628, 1629, 1630/ EN 1627, increased burglary protection, class RC 2/ RC 2 N., PAS 24 + RC 4.
-
-
Performance characteristics
To DIN 18008-4 Anti-fall protection, category A.
